Floyd Lucian Brown (March 28, 1888 – July 9, 1971) was an American college football player and coach. He served as the head football coach at Lombard College in Galesburg, Illinois from 1913 to 1915 and Lake Forest College in Lake Forest, Illinois from 1924 to 1928.
